Latest Patents
Aguilar's latest patents include a "Variable exposure portable perfusion monitor." This invention involves a method of imaging a target by acquiring multiple images with different exposure values. The processor of the imaging apparatus determines temporal and/or spatial variances for these images and generates a perfusion image of the target based on the results.
Another significant patent is the "Device and method for the preparation and operation on biological specimen." This device is designed for shaping tissue and features a tip with an internal closed-loop circulation system. The tip connects to tubes, one of which links to a submersible cold-water pump, while another serves as an outlet. The design includes a sapphire window and a shaft with a laser fiber, allowing for precise laser beam operation.
